Vegetable Beef Soup


Serves: 6
Total Calories: 258

Ingredients

2 cups left over roast beef or beef stew meat
1 package beef stew seasoning mix
1 quart tomato
6 cups water
2 teaspoons beef bouillon
4 potatoes
4 carrots
1 cup chopped celery
1 (15 1/4-ounce) can corn, drained
1 chopped onion
1 (15 1/4-ounce) can green beans, drained
1 zucchini
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per

Directions:

Cut roast in pieces or brown beef stew meat in small amount of oil. Mix together beef stew seasoning mix, tomatoes, water, bouillon and meat. Bring to boil. Lower heat, cover and simmer for 1 hour. Peel and cube potatoes and carrots. Wash and cube zucchini. Add rest of ingredients and simmer for 30 minutes.

For crock-pot, brown beef and add with rest of ingredients to crock-pot. Cook on low for 7 to 8 hours.
